# $Header: /cvsroot/nsnam/ns-2/tcl/lib/ns-cmutrace.tcl,v 1.3 2003/09/27 01:01:31 aditi Exp $
CMUTrace instproc init { tname type } {
$self next $tname $type
$self instvar type_ src_ dst_ callback_ show_tcphdr_
set type_ $type
set src_ 0
set dst_ 0
set callback_ 0
set show_tcphdr_ 0
}
CMUTrace instproc attach fp {
$self instvar fp_
set fp_ $fp
$self cmd attach $fp_
}
Class CMUTrace/Send -superclass CMUTrace
CMUTrace/Send instproc init { tname } {
$self next $tname "s"
}
Class CMUTrace/Recv -superclass CMUTrace
CMUTrace/Recv instproc init { tname } {
$self next $tname "r"
}
Class CMUTrace/Drop -superclass CMUTrace
CMUTrace/Drop instproc init { tname } {
$self next $tname "D"
}
Class CMUTrace/EOT -superclass CMUTrace
CMUTrace/EOT instproc init { tname } {
$self next $tname "x"
}
# XXX MUST NOT initialize off_*_ here!!
# They should be automatically initialized in ns-packet.tcl!!
CMUTrace/Recv set src_ 0
CMUTrace/Recv set dst_ 0
CMUTrace/Recv set callback_ 0
CMUTrace/Recv set show_tcphdr_ 0
CMUTrace/Send set src_ 0
CMUTrace/Send set dst_ 0
CMUTrace/Send set callback_ 0
CMUTrace/Send set show_tcphdr_ 0
CMUTrace/Drop set src_ 0
CMUTrace/Drop set dst_ 0
CMUTrace/Drop set callback_ 0
CMUTrace/Drop set show_tcphdr_ 0
CMUTrace/EOT set src_ 0
CMUTrace/EOT set dst_ 0
CMUTrace/EOT set callback_ 0
CMUTrace/EOT set show_tcphdr_ 0
